  • In a period before Belgium existed, Laurent-Benoît Dewez (1731-1812) was undoubtedly the most prominent architect in our region. As court architect to the Austrian governor Charles of Lorraine, he was known for his contributions to neoclassical architecture, a style popular during the late 18th century. More specifically, his oeuvre was dominated by the creation of a unitary ‘Eglise Belgique’.
    Today, Dewez's vast oeuvre is still present in our (Leuven) streetscape. Yet only a select few still seem to know him....

  • This year, 2025, is marked in Liège by a double anniversary: the 350th anniversary of the death of Bertholet Flémal, one of the greatest painters the Principality of Liège has ever produced, and the 175th anniversary of the founding of the Institut archéologique liégeois, the oldest historical and archaeological society in the province of Liège. Against this backdrop, the Liège Cathedral Treasury, in partnership with the Institute, is organising a retrospective devoted to Bertholet Flémal (1614-1675). Starting with the two...

  • For several years now, summer exhibitions have been held in Dendermonde's Church of Our Lady under the heading ‘IN SITU’. In 2024 it was Antoon Van Dyck's Calvary's turn, focusing on the restoration of this masterpiece. In 2025, it will be artist Harold Van de Perre's turn with his stained-glass window ‘Heavenly Jerusalem’ located in the right transept of the church. This stained-glass window will be the centre of a major exhibition covering his entire career as a stained-glass artist....
